Jake Hastie has left Rangers after signing a permanent deal at Hartlepool United.New Pools boss Paul Hartley has moved swiftly to snap up the former Motherwell winger, and has also signed Euan Murray from Kilmarnock for the English League Two side.Hastie, 23, had been at Rangers since moving from Fir Park in 2019 on a four-year deal, but had been out on loan at Rotherham United, Motherwell, Partick Thistle and Linfield since then.Hartlepool boss Paul Hartley, who is originally from Hamilton and was a hero at Celtic, told the club's website: "Delighted to get Jake in.

Someone I’ve seen a lot of. He needs a change of scenery. Still a young lad."He needs a home and somewhere where someone can believe him.

He’s got real pace. Very good in one on one situations and I know he will bring a lot of excitement."Hastie said: "This is an exciting move for me.

I'm ready to push on and help the team the best way I can."I've seen a lot of videos and pictures of the fans, and I can see they create an unbelievable atmosphere.
